A Century of Sonnets: The Romantic-Era Revival 1750-1850

A Century of Sonnets: The Romantic-Era Revival 1750-1850 more books like this

by Professor Paula R Feldman (Editor), Daniel Robinson (Editor)

"A Century of Sonnets" is a striking reminder that some of the best-known and most well-respected poems of the Romantic era were sonnets. It presents the broad and rich context of such favourites as Percy Bysshe Shelley's "Ozymandias," John Keats' "On First Looking into Chapman's Homer" and William Wordsworth's "Composed Upon Westminster Bridge" ...

British Women Poets of the Romantic Era: An Anthology

British Women Poets of the Romantic Era: An Anthology more books like this

by Professor Paula R Feldman (Editor)

Many readers still associate the Romantic era with six major poets: Samuel Taylor Coleridge, William Wordsworth, Percy Bysshe Shelly, Lord Byron, John Keats, and William Blake. But recently, critics have challenged this all-male canon, pointing out that, during the Romantic period, women such as Joanna Baillie, Anna Letitia Barbauld, Felicia ...

Records of Woman, W/Other Poems-Pa

Records of Woman, W/Other Poems-Pa more books like this

by Felicia Hemans (Editor), Professor Paula R Feldman (Editor)

Felicia Hemans (1793-1835) was one of the most popular and influential poets of the 19th century. Her work explores the meaning of being a woman, along with the character and history of the female sex.

A Mary Shelley Encyclopedia

A Mary Shelley Encyclopedia more books like this

by Professor Paula R Feldman, Lucy Morrison, Staci L Stone

Mary Shelley has only recently emerged from the shadows of her famous parents, Mary Wollstonecraft and William Godwin, and her husband, Percy Bysshe Shelley. Today, "Frankenstein" (1818, 1831) is one of the most popular classroom texts in high school and college, and her other works are attracting renewed attention. These works reveal much about ...
